What to Look for in Best Translation Software 2026

When selecting the best translation software for 2026, consider several key features that cater to both professional and casual users:

  1. Language Support: Ensure the software supports a wide range of languages, including less common ones like Amharic or Quechua, in addition to major world languages such as English, Spanish, Mandarin, and Arabic.
  1. Accuracy and Contextual Understanding: Look for tools that offer high accuracy rates across various contexts, from technical documents to creative writing. Advanced software should be able to understand nuances and idioms specific to different cultures and dialects.
  1. Customization Options: The ability to customize dictionaries or add specialized terminology is crucial for industries like law, medicine, or technology where precise language is essential.
  1. Integration Capabilities: Choose software that integrates seamlessly with other tools you use daily, such as Microsoft Office, Google Docs, or translation management systems (TMS).
  1. Real-Time Collaboration: For teams working on multilingual projects, real-time collaboration features allow multiple users to edit and review translations simultaneously.
  1. Machine Learning and AI Enhancements: Look for software that leverages the latest advancements in machine learning and artificial intelligence to improve translation quality over time as it learns from user interactions.
  1. User Interface and Accessibility: A clean, intuitive interface makes the tool easier to use, especially for non-technical users or those working under tight deadlines. Additionally, consider accessibility features like screen reader compatibility.
  1. Security and Data Privacy: Ensure that the software complies with relevant data protection regulations (like GDPR) and offers robust security measures to protect sensitive information during translation processes.
  1. Customer Support and Community Resources: Reliable customer support is crucial for troubleshooting issues or learning advanced features. Access to community forums, tutorials, and webinars can also enhance your experience.
  1. Cost-Effectiveness: Evaluate the pricing model (subscription-based, pay-per-use) and consider whether it aligns with your budget and usage needs without compromising on quality.

By focusing on these criteria, you can find a translation software that meets your specific requirements for efficiency, accuracy, and ease of use in 2026.
